Mid Power LEDs Market size was valued at USD 10.5 Billion in 2022 and is projected to reach USD 17.8 Billion by 2030, growing at a CAGR of 7.5% from 2024 to 2030.
The Mid Power LEDs market is experiencing significant growth due to its broad range of applications across various industries. These LEDs are valued for their energy efficiency, long lifespan, and high-performance capabilities, making them ideal for use in diverse settings such as industrial, commercial, automotive, and residential sectors. The widespread adoption of Mid Power LEDs in these applications is driven by the increasing demand for energy-saving lighting solutions, technological advancements, and rising awareness about sustainability. The key benefit of Mid Power LEDs is their ability to deliver high luminous output at a relatively lower power consumption compared to traditional lighting systems, making them a preferred choice for both commercial and residential lighting solutions.

In the industrial sector, Mid Power LEDs are commonly used for a wide range of lighting applications, including factory floor illumination, streetlights, and warehouse lighting. Their ability to provide bright, efficient, and reliable lighting in high-demand environments has made them a key lighting source in this industry. Industrial spaces often require lighting solutions that can operate for extended periods, withstand harsh conditions, and reduce operational costs. Mid Power LEDs meet these needs, as they are highly durable, resistant to vibration, and designed for longevity, reducing the frequency of maintenance and replacement costs. Furthermore, with advancements in LED technology, these LEDs offer precise control over light intensity, making them ideal for specific industrial environments where lighting needs can vary throughout the day.
Moreover, the integration of Mid Power LEDs in industrial applications contributes to energy efficiency and cost savings. For example, in warehouses and manufacturing plants, these LEDs can replace traditional lighting systems such as fluorescent or halogen lights, leading to substantial reductions in electricity consumption. Additionally, these lighting solutions help enhance worker safety by offering clear visibility and reducing the potential for accidents in low-light areas. As industries worldwide continue to embrace more sustainable practices, the demand for energy-efficient lighting solutions like Mid Power LEDs is expected to rise steadily, cementing their role in industrial infrastructure for the long term.
In the commercial sector, Mid Power LEDs are extensively used for lighting applications in retail stores, offices, shopping malls, and public spaces. Their ability to provide bright, even lighting while minimizing energy consumption has made them a go-to solution for commercial establishments looking to improve lighting quality while reducing overhead costs. Retail environments, for instance, benefit greatly from the vibrant and consistent light quality provided by Mid Power LEDs, which enhances product displays and attracts customer attention. In offices and public spaces, these LEDs are used to create well-lit environments that improve productivity and comfort for employees and visitors alike. Additionally, commercial properties can achieve significant cost savings by switching to energy-efficient lighting solutions, helping businesses meet sustainability targets and reduce their carbon footprint.
The versatility of Mid Power LEDs also extends to their ease of integration with advanced lighting control systems, such as dimming and motion-sensing technologies, which further enhance their energy-saving potential. By incorporating these smart technologies, commercial establishments can optimize lighting conditions based on real-time occupancy and usage, reducing unnecessary power consumption. The growing emphasis on sustainability, energy efficiency, and aesthetic appeal in commercial lighting is expected to drive further adoption of Mid Power LEDs in this segment, making them an essential part of modern commercial infrastructures.
Mid Power LEDs have found wide-ranging applications in the automotive industry, particularly for lighting systems in vehicles. These LEDs are used in a variety of automotive lighting systems, including headlights, tail lights, interior lighting, and dashboard illumination. The automotive industry values Mid Power LEDs for their compact size, durability, energy efficiency, and ability to deliver high brightness levels. In headlights and taillights, these LEDs not only enhance vehicle safety by providing better illumination but also offer significant improvements in energy efficiency compared to conventional incandescent bulbs. This is particularly important as automotive manufacturers strive to reduce the overall energy consumption of vehicles, especially with the growing trend toward electric and hybrid vehicles.
Additionally, the automotive sector benefits from the design flexibility offered by Mid Power LEDs. Their small form factor allows manufacturers to create sleek, modern lighting designs for vehicle exteriors and interiors, contributing to the overall aesthetics of the vehicle. Moreover, advancements in LED technology have led to improvements in their performance, making them more reliable and longer-lasting than traditional lighting options. As electric vehicles (EVs) gain popularity, the demand for energy-efficient automotive lighting solutions is expected to grow, further driving the adoption of Mid Power LEDs in the automotive sector. As a result, Mid Power LEDs are poised to remain a central component of the automotive lighting market for years to come.
In the residential market, Mid Power LEDs are increasingly popular for a wide array of lighting applications, from general illumination to accent lighting in homes. These LEDs offer significant advantages in terms of energy efficiency, cost-effectiveness, and environmental sustainability, making them an attractive option for homeowners looking to reduce their energy consumption and lower utility bills. Mid Power LEDs are used in various residential lighting solutions, such as ceiling lights, lamps, recessed lighting, and landscape lighting, all of which benefit from the energy-saving and long-lasting features of these LEDs. As homeowners become more conscious of their environmental impact, the demand for eco-friendly lighting solutions has surged, making Mid Power LEDs a go-to choice for residential lighting needs.
In addition to their energy-saving capabilities, Mid Power LEDs are also valued for their aesthetic flexibility. These LEDs are available in a wide range of colors, brightness levels, and designs, allowing homeowners to customize their lighting according to personal preferences and the ambiance of different rooms. The low heat emission of Mid Power LEDs also contributes to a more comfortable living environment, reducing the risk of overheating and fire hazards that can sometimes be associated with traditional incandescent lighting. As the market for energy-efficient residential lighting continues to expand, Mid Power LEDs are expected to play a pivotal role in reshaping home lighting systems, further driving their adoption in residential applications.

1. What are Mid Power LEDs?
Mid Power LEDs are energy-efficient light-emitting diodes that provide moderate levels of brightness, typically used in applications requiring lower light output than high-power LEDs but more intensity than low-power options.
2. How do Mid Power LEDs compare to high-power LEDs?
Mid Power LEDs are designed for applications requiring moderate brightness and are more energy-efficient, while high-power LEDs are used for more demanding, high-intensity applications.
3. What industries use Mid Power LEDs?
Mid Power LEDs are widely used in industrial, commercial, automotive, and residential applications due to their energy efficiency and long lifespan.
4. Are Mid Power LEDs cost-effective?
Yes, Mid Power LEDs are cost-effective because they have lower initial costs and offer substantial long-term savings in energy and maintenance.
5. How long do Mid Power LEDs last?
Mid Power LEDs typically have a lifespan of 25,000 to 50,000 hours, making them more durable and long-lasting than traditional lighting options.
6. Can Mid Power LEDs be dimmed?
Yes, many Mid Power LEDs are compatible with dimming systems, allowing users to adjust brightness levels according to their needs.
7. Are Mid Power LEDs environmentally friendly?
Yes, Mid Power LEDs are environmentally friendly as they consume less energy, reduce carbon footprints, and have fewer toxic elements compared to traditional lighting solutions.
8. What are the advantages of using Mid Power LEDs in residential settings?
In residential settings, Mid Power LEDs provide energy savings, lower heat emission, and longer lifespan, reducing overall maintenance and energy costs.
9. What are some examples of Mid Power LED applications?
Examples include factory floor lighting, office lighting, vehicle headlights, and home ceiling lights, where moderate brightness and efficiency are required.
